I have a 10.04 machine that I just tried to upgrade to 12.04. I used
update-manager-text. It ran and at the end said something like 'upgrade
completed but there were errors'. Unhelpfully, it didn't give me the
option to see the errors or tell me where it keeps a log etc.

I tried to discover using google and found
https://wiki.ubuntu.com/DebuggingUpdateManager but sadly that gave a 500
internal error. The page now seems to have fixed itself but it's not
relevant to my problem.

I rebooted and the system came up but via a partly broken boot process.
I appear now to be back in 10.04 and the system warns me there are 52
broken packages. But the simple commands I've done so far have been OK.

How do I:
- find out what went wrong
- set about fixing broken things
- set about completing the upgrade

Any pointers gratefully received.
